Oracle では、「drop directory」ステートメントを使用してディレクトリを削除できます。このステートメントは、指定されたディレクトリ エイリアスを削除するために使用されます。構文は「drop directory DIRENAME;」です。ディレクトリはインポートに使用されます。そしてデータベースをエクスポートします。
このチュートリアルの動作環境: Windows 10 システム、Oracle バージョン 12c、Dell G3 コンピューター。
ディレクトリ directory を削除する
構文は次のとおりです:
drop directory DIRENAME;
ディレクトリの目的 データのインポートとエクスポート
1. クエリ ディレクトリ directory
select * from dba_directories;
2. ディレクトリ ディレクトリの作成または変更
create or replace directory dum_date_dir as '/home/oracle/datatmp'
3. Empower ディレクトリ ディレクトリ
grant read,write on directory dumpdir to username;
拡張知識:
Oracle Directory (ディレクトリ) を使用すると、ユーザーは Oracle データベース内のファイルを柔軟に読み書きできるようになり、Oracle の使いやすさと拡張性が大幅に向上します。構文は次のとおりです。
CREATE [OR REPLACE] DIRECTORY DIRECTORY AS 'PATHNAME';
ディレクトリを作成および削除する権限は、CREATE ANY DIRECTORY、DROP ANY DIRECTORY です。 Directory を使用するために一般ユーザーに与えられる権限には、READ、WRITE、および EXECUTE が含まれます。また、以下に示すように、ALL を直接書き込むこともできます:
GRANT READ,WRITE,EXECUTE ON DIRECTORY EXP_DIR_LHR TO LHR; GRANT ALL ON DIRECTORY EXP_DIR_LHR TO LHR;
Directory データベース オブジェクトを作成するときは、対応するパスが指定されることに注意してください。存在しません、および存在しません。エラーを報告するとき、Oracle データベースはオペレーティング システム上のパスの存在を検証しません。パスが使用されるときにのみ存在を検証します。したがって、ディレクトリを作成するときは、次の点に注意してください。対応するパスが存在する場合、ORA-29913 または ORA が報告される可能性があります。 -29400 エラー。
次は、Oracle Directory の作成例です:
推奨チュートリアル: 「Oracle ビデオ チュートリアル 」
以上がOracleでディレクトリを削除する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。